What Makes UPVC Different?

UPVC means unplasticized polyvinyl chloride, a stiff kind of PVC that has actually been processed without the plasticizers that make standard PVC flexible. This material has actually been fine-tuned over years particularly for https://lorenzoxowz493.iamarrows.com/10-folding-window-doors-tips-all-experts-recommend construction applications, and its properties make it incredibly well-suited for door and window frames. Unlike wood, which can warp, rot, or require routine painting, UPVC keeps its structural integrity with minimal intervention. Unlike aluminum, which can perform cold and heat easily, UPVC supplies natural thermal insulation that helps preserve comfortable indoor temperatures throughout the year.

The production process for UPVC profiles involves extruding the product into complex multi-chambered profiles that strengthen strength while reducing weight. These chambers develop thermal barriers that prevent heat transfer through the frame itself, working in combination with double or triple-glazed systems to create detailed thermal efficiency. The product's inherent resistance to chemical destruction, moisture, and UV radiation suggests that quality UPVC items retain their look and functionality far longer than many options.

The Compelling Advantages of UPVC

Energy efficiency represents possibly the most engaging benefit for environmentally mindful house owners and those seeking to decrease energy expenses. The thermal insulation residential or commercial properties of UPVC frames significantly lower heat transfer in between the interior and outside of a home. Throughout cold weather, heat produced by heating systems remains within longer, while during summer, the insulation avoids hot outdoor air from penetrating cooled interiors. This thermal barrier implies that heating and cooling systems operate less frequently and less intensively, translating directly into lower energy consumption and decreased utility bills.

The toughness of UPVC is worthy of particular attention from anyone examining window and door alternatives. Quality UPVC products generally bring guarantees ranging from ten to twenty-five years, with numerous setups lasting forty years or more when correctly preserved. Unlike wood frames that need sanding, staining, or painting every couple of years, UPVC frames need just occasional cleansing with soap and water to maintain their look. The product does not absorb wetness, so it never swells or develops rot, and it stays resistant to the insect damage that often afflicts wood options.

Security factors to consider make UPVC an outstanding choice for safety-minded house owners. Modern UPVC windows and doors include multi-point locking systems that engage at several points along the frame, making break-in considerably harder than with basic single-point locks. The frames themselves are constructed from products that resist drilling and cutting, and when combined with suitable glazing, develop powerful barriers versus invasion. Insurer frequently acknowledge these security features, potentially providing lowered premiums for homes equipped with quality UPVC doors and windows.

Designs and Applications

UPVC technology has actually advanced considerably, enabling manufacturers to produce profiles that imitate standard wood window designs while supplying modern performance benefits. Casement windows, which hinge at the side and open outside like doors, represent the most typical UPVC window design and deal outstanding ventilation and clear sightlines. Tilt-and-turn windows supply versatile operation, opening like casement windows for ventilation or swinging inward like doors for easy cleansing. Moving patio doors and lift-and-slide systems make the most of glass location for natural light and outside views while preserving outstanding thermal performance.

Entryway doors manufactured from UPVC have evolved beyond basic slab styles to consist of alternatives with ornamental glass panels, sidelights, and advanced color finishes that complement numerous architectural designs. French doors, which feature two operable panels that swing outside or inward, produce stylish transitions between indoor and outdoor areas. Residential UPVC doors can be manufactured in a large range of sizes to accommodate basic openings or custom-made requirements, ensuring that homeowners require not compromise on aesthetic vision to delight in product advantages.

Financial Considerations

While UPVC doors and windows typically cost less than equivalent wood or aluminum products, the overall financial investment includes numerous elements beyond unit costs. Expert installation guarantees correct fitting, appropriate sealing, and manufacturer warranty protection, though it includes to upfront costs. Double or triple glazing increases thermal performance however also increases per-unit costs. Customized sizes, specialized colors, and complex setups all influence final pricing.

Despite these factors to consider, the long-lasting economics of UPVC frequently prove favorable. Minimized maintenance expenses get rid of ongoing expenses related to painting, staining, or repairing alternative products. Improved energy effectiveness creates continuous cost savings that accumulate considerably over the lifespan of the products. The toughness that prevents replacement requirements for decades means that the preliminary financial investment distributes across lots of years of trustworthy service, leading to beneficial life time expense comparisons even when alternative products carry lower initial costs.

Often Asked Questions

For how long do UPVC windows and doors generally last?

Quality UPVC doors and windows generally last between thirty and forty years with proper installation and routine upkeep. Many producers provide service warranties of twenty-five years or more on the frame stability, and the real service life frequently surpasses service warranty periods. Elements influencing durability consist of installation quality, exposure to extreme weather, and the frequency of operation for movable parts.

Are UPVC windows and windows suitable for all environment conditions?

UPVC carries out well across a large range of climate conditions, from hot and damp tropical areas to cold northern environments. The material withstands moisture damage, keeps structural integrity across temperature variations, and provides excellent thermal insulation in both heating and cooling climates. Some makers use specialized formulas with improved UV resistance for especially sunny regions, making sure color stability and avoiding surface deterioration over extended exposure.

Can UPVC windows and doors be painted or ended up in various colors?

While UPVC profiles come produced in various colors, the material can be painted with specialized finishings designed for PVC substrates. Nevertheless, factory-applied surfaces usually supply remarkable sturdiness and color retention compared to field-applied paints. Property owners thinking about color choices need to explore maker color catalogs, which now consist of alternatives ranging from timeless white and cream to woodgrain finishes and contemporary gray tones.

Do UPVC doors and windows contribute to home resale worth?

Quality doors and windows typically enhance resale worth by enhancing energy performance, security, and curb appeal. While UPVC items might not carry the status association of natural wood for high-end residential or commercial properties, they attract useful purchasers who acknowledge their durability and efficiency advantages. Standardized sizes and availability of replacement parts also make UPVC setups appealing to buyers planning long-lasting occupancy.
